## `ssh_exchange_identification` error
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
|
Users may experience the following error when attempting to push or pull
|
||||||
|
using Git over SSH:
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
|
```
|
||||||
|
Please make sure you have the correct access rights
|
||||||
|
and the repository exists.
|
||||||
|
...
|
||||||
|
ssh_exchange_identification: read: Connection reset by peer
|
||||||
|
fatal: Could not read from remote repository.
|
||||||
|
```
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
|
This error usually indicates that SSH daemon's `MaxStartups` value is throttling
|
||||||
|
SSH connections. This setting specifies the maximum number of unauthenticated
|
||||||
|
connections to the SSH daemon. This affects users with proper authentication
|
||||||
|
credentials (SSH keys) because every connection is 'unauthenticated' in the
|
||||||
|
beginning. The default value is `10`.
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
|
Increase `MaxStartups` by adding or modifying the value in `/etc/ssh/sshd_config`:
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
|
```
|
||||||
|
MaxStartups 100
|
||||||
|
```
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
|
Restart SSHD for the change to take effect.
